Summary:
In his final work, Murakami confronts three crucial questions: How and in what form can a harmonious and stable post-cold-war world order be created? How can the world maintain the necessary economic performance while minimizing conflicts and environmental deterioration? What must be done to safeguard the freedoms of all peoples?
